The House of Telmont was founded in 1912 by Henri Lhôpital, a courageous wine grower, following the Champagne riots of 1911, in the village of Damery, near Epernay. The House is rich in ancestral know-how: four generations of winegrowers bequeathed their strong commitment to their terroir and their grapes to their successors, as well as the art of mastering each stage of wine making. Within their vineyards, important steps had been taken to transition towards organic agriculture. The encounter with Bertrand Lhôpital, fourth generation of the founding family, confirmed that the Rémy Cointreau Group and Telmont would form a unique partnership. The Group identified with the values of the House and proceeded to purchase a majority share in October 2020. Agricultural engineer, currently Head of Viticulture and Cellar Master of Telmont, Bertrand had already started transitioning several hectares of vines to organic agriculture. The never-ending winter was followed by a very cool, late spring. we had to wait until the start of July for flowering to begin â€?something we hadn’t seen in Champagne for quite some time! Fortunately, summer was glorious with plenty of sunshine, record temperatures and very low rainfall, ideal for the ripening of the Pinot Noirs and Chardonnays. the temperatures were cool for the October harvest and the resulting wines are elegant and fresh â€?the signs of a “classicâ€?vintage.rrTechnical Information:rVineyards: Premier Cru & Grand Cru | Damery 66%,Ay 11%, Cumieres 8%, Caumuzy 5%, Boursault 4% & Others 6% rGrape Varieties: 43% Meunier | 31% Pinot Noir | 26% ChardonnayrLees Ageing: 8 yearsrDisgorged: October 2022rDosage: 2.5 g/lrVinification: 45% in oak casks | 55% in stainless steel vatsrMalolactic Fermentation: 0%rAlcohol: 12.5%rDrink:Now to 2032rProduction: 36,850 BottlesrrTasting Note: Meunier from Telmont’s home village of Damery dominates this oak-complexed blend. The rich, evolved nose sees spicy woody notes adding complexity to the ripe, sweet red-fruit core of vanilla, strawberry, apple compote and red apple. Lots of evolution on the nose already, with oxidative tones under control. The sturdy palate is surprisingly full of energy after the mellow, aged tones of the nose. The beautiful acid line brings a lovely juiciness to the wine. Concentrated and long. â€?Tasted by Essi Avellan MW
